The movie “The Help” tells an answer for all these questions. It is a powerful story set in Mississippi, during the time of racial inequality. The movie shows how the Black maids are treated badly in that time, and how they come forward to share their painful experiences with a young white writer, Skeeter. While unity did not take as the main theme of the movie, but without Black maids’ courage, their stories would remain silenced. This courage reminds us that unity is the key in making sure that the voices are heard and create a change in society. This movie shows unity as a powerful thing which highlights how the maids come together to tell their stories even without considering the risks to their safety, jobs, and their lives. In their shared experiences, they find collective strength to voice against racial injustice, and the involvement of Skeeter reflects that even those who are not directly affected should stand together to face the injustice.

In the movie, the maids' decision to share their stories is a bravery act, as it forces them to face their fear and to speak out their problems. At the beginning of the movie, the maids are very much afraid to tell their stories. The fear of losing their jobs, facing severe punishments, or  risking their lives keeps them silent. This fear is made by the widespread of racism that treats them as unimportant in the society. However, the arrest of one Black maid, as she suspects of a theft, serves as a turning point. This situation makes an emotion and anger within the Black maids. They have no strength to hold their frustrations anymore. They realize that silence only supports injustice, so they decide to share their stories without any fear. So this act, it proves that unity can turn fear into strength. By choosing to speak out, they take the first step to challenge the racism in their society.

        The shared experiences of injustice of Black maids form a powerful bond and it gives them the strength to challenge the racial inequality. Throughout the movie, the maids' individual stories of mistreatment and inequality may seem small on their own, if only one person experience suffering in the movie, it is hard to show the powerful message of the movie. But when the stories are combined, they create a collective strength that can no longer be ignored. As each maid shares their experiences, they realize that they are not alone in their suffering. This shared understanding of injustice shows the power of unity. For example, when Aibileen and Minny share their painful experiences by their white employers makes an impact to the other maids to share their bad experiences also. The strength of unity among the maids is undestroyable after that. By sharing their experiences, they not only support each other but also create a powerful force to challenge racial inequality. Their collective strength proves that standing together to face a problem is a powerful tool for changing the world.

In the movie, Skeeter’s role highlights the importance of standing up for justice, even if it is not directly affected by injustice. In today’s world, many people live selfishly, everyone ignores the struggles and injustices faced by others until they are personally impacted. Most people remain without any care when someone suffers because they think that it is not their problem. However, Skeeter shows us the power of supporting injustice, even when we are not affected. As a white woman, Skeeter is not personally affected by the mistreatment that the Black maids face. Even though she listens to their stories and makes a situation where the entire world listens to their stories. Without Skeeter’s support to write about the maids’ experiences, their voices would remain silenced. Skeeter’s role in the story teaches us a valuable lesson that we all have a responsibility to stand up against injustice even if we are not affected. Her support to the Black maids shows that the fight for justice requires more than just the voices of those directly affected.
